The Brooks Ghost Max 3 and Brooks Glycerin Max 2 are both oversized, comfort-first Brooks trainers, but despite sharing the same "Max" moniker, they perform different functions. The Ghost Max 3 is the lower-stack, more stable option, with a broad base and plush upper that make it feel secure for walking, easy efforts, and slow daily mileage. However, its midsole feels flat, with very little rebound when you try to pick up the pace. The Glycerin Max 2 adds much deeper cushioning, a stronger rocker, and better responsiveness, making it better suited to long runs and heavier runners who want reliable protection underfoot. It's heavier and less stable than the Ghost Max 3, but it gives you a more complete max-cushion ride.
